The Windsor Wizards will square off against the Riverdale Ridge Ravens at 6:30 p.m. on Thursday. Both squads will be entering this one on the heels of a big victory.
Riverdale Ridge will face off against a team with plenty of momentum: Windsor extended their winning streak to six on Tuesday. The Wizards never let Loveland get on the board and left with a 9-0 victory. Windsor's defense has been rock solid lately; the team hasn't given up a goal in their last five matches.
Their offense was hitting Loveland from everywhere, as five different players booted in a goal. Tatum Gentry led that balanced group of strikers and accounted for four goals all by herself.
Meanwhile, there's no place like home for Riverdale Ridge, who bounced back after a loss on the road on Thursday. They blew past Northglenn 8-1 on Tuesday. The high-scoring effort was just what Riverdale Ridge needed considering they were shut out in their previous contest.
Riverdale Ridge is on a roll lately: they've won eight of their last nine games. That's provided a nice bump to their 11-2-1 record this season. Those wins came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they scored 42 goals over those nine matchups. As for Windsor, they pushed their record up to 11-3 with the victory, which was their third straight on the road.
